Irreducible polynomials over $\mathbb{F}_{2^r}$ with three prescribed coefficients (1805.07105v2)
Abstract: For any positive integers $n \ge 3$ and $r \ge 1$, we prove that the number of monic irreducible polynomials of degree $n$ over $\mathbb{F}{2r}$ in which the coefficients of $T{n-1}$, $T{n-2}$ and $T{n-3}$ are prescribed has period $24$ as a function of $n$, after a suitable normalization. A similar result holds over $\mathbb{F}{5r}$, with the period being $60$. We also show that this is a phenomena unique to characteristics $2$ and $5$. The result is strongly related to the supersingularity of certain curves associated with cyclotomic function fields, and in particular it complements an equidistribution result of Katz.
